are you saying I'm fat?

One time I was at a big academic conference in Vancouver, BC (that's British Columbia, not "before the time of Christ"), and I was walking around the hallways of a large hotel looking for the room where the panel I wanted to attend was scheduled to be held. (Really? That sentence needed that many words? Sometimes English sucks, or maybe it's just me that sucks.) All the rooms had ocean-related names because, get this, Vancouver is near the ocean!

Anyway, as I was trying simultaneously to navigate a crowded hallway, read my program, consult the hotel map, hold onto my purse, the official conference tote bag, a pepsi and a couple of books, and figure out which way I should be walking, a friend of mine stopped me in the hallway with a question. This guy, my friend, was someone I knew from a Heidegger reading group I had been in for years. We liked each other, and had a shared love of bourbon and off-color jokes, but we weren't totally close friends, which is why what happened next was at all possible.

He said, "Do you know where the Orca room is?" And I said, "ARE YOU SAYING I'M FAT?!" because to me there is nothing more hilarious than joking about how women tend to be obsessed with weight and men don't know how to deal with it. I mean, he basically was trying to say that I looked like a whale, RIGHT?! Hilarious. But he thought I was serious and started stammering reasons why that was not at all what he was saying. Which was a new kind of hilarious, yes. But I had assumed he would know I was joking--a different kind of hilarious. Maybe I should be bummed that he wasn't clear on that right away? Not because of him--he's no dummy or anything--but because even though he didn't know me that well, I guess I would have wanted it to be clear to anyone who ever encountered me, however briefly, in the history of the world, that I would never interpret an innocent search for a room named Orca as an attack on my uncontroversially non-fat body condition. But such is the reality of the world in which we live that of course he would err on the side of thinking I am insane. Because all this bodyfat stuff is INSANE.

In other news, I am on a diet. It is a diet that involves white wine, brownies, exercise, and reasonable restraint with regard to unhealthy food choices.
